Transaction 9090e50fcabe232f260fd39e33162b9463779f174532007a4e143462a5e12ad4
1 Input
1 Output
-
9090e50fcabe232f260fd39e33162b9463779f174532007a4e143462a5e12ad4:0
- value
- 4526723986
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e8c31fcd12eef54a37f2c5f97deb023d46517ef
- address
- bc1q96xrrlx39mh4fgml930e0h4sy02x29l0ckn724